specter539 wrote:what was the obsession with cybiko? i bought one too a while back. i think they are crap and i messed my bios up on mine or something. It was a good idea.
My obsession was that they were $12 on clearance so I bought one for EVERYBODY I knew. I kept two for myself. Then I got married to somebody with one of the ones I gave out so I have 3.

When they weren't on clearance they were fantastically unpopular. The TV ads were incredible though. In truth, it was a great little system with some surprisingly good games and a fair number of useful features.

Mind you it was a great system for $12, not $99.
